Tenerina Cake

Directly from the tradition of the City of Ferrara

The cake Tenerina is a speciality and the pride of the city of Ferrara. Prepared with a base of dark chocolate, butter, sugar, eggs and very little flour, baked once has the distinction to remain low and with a heart tender and moist. A real treat for lovers of chocolate.

INGREDIENTS

  • 200 gr dark chocolate
  • 125 gr butter
  • 2 eggs
  • 100 gr sugar
  • 2 scant tablespoons of flour
  • pinch of salt

RECIPE METHOD

  1. Melt the chocolate in a double boiler until it becomes creamy and smooth.
  2. Add the butter cubes and let the mixture cool.
  3. Meanwhile, whip the egg yolks with the sugar, whisk well until the mixture is light and fluffy.
  4. Always beating, add the butter and chocolate mixture to the egg yolks and the sugar and flour.
  5. Pour the cream into a large bowl. If the butter is too thick, add a little milk, should be smooth and creamy.
  6. Separately, whip the egg whites with a pinch of salt, beat until it forms a compact white cream and then, embed them gently into the chocolate mixture (from bottom to top).
  7. Grease and flour a cake pan with a diameter of 24 cm and pour in the cake batter.
  8. Bake in a preheated oven at 180 degrees for 25-30 minutes, then turn off the oven and let cool the cake, taking the oven door open. After, place it on a platter and sprinkle with powdered sugar.
